Mainstreet to Acquire CareIT for $425M

11/19/17

Mainstreet Health Investments (TSX: HLP-U) announced that it has entered into definitive agreements with Tiptree Inc. (NASDAQ: TIPT) and certain subsidiaries, to acquire Care Investment Trust LLC for an aggregate purchase price of approximately US$425 million. CareIT owns a portfolio of 42 seniors housing and care properties comprising 3,718 suites/beds in attractive markets across the United States. Furthermore, Mainstreet intends to change its operating name to Invesque Inc., which will provide the Company with a unique and recognizable name.

Transformative and Strategic Acquisition

Attractive and Strategic Portfolio Acquisition: The Portfolio is comprised of 35 high quality independent living, assisted living and memory care properties and seven skilled nursing facilities located in growing markets across 11 states. The Portfolio is expected to add eight new states to Mainstreet’s existing platform and strengthens its presence in three states in which it currently owns properties. The Portfolio consists of 24 properties leased to operators under long-term triple-net leases and 18 operating properties in joint venture arrangements with seniors housing operators in which Mainstreet will own the majority of the real estate and the operations.

Enhanced Scale and Investment Platform: The Transaction increases the scale and scope of Mainstreet’s investment platform to comprise 80 properties with 8,536 suites/beds across the United States and Canada, a 2.6x increase compared to Mainstreet’s initial public offering in June 2016. The Company’s pro forma asset value is expected to increase to US$1.2 billion.

Transaction Significantly Improves Diversification: The Transaction further diversifies the Company’s operator relationships and geographic footprint. Mainstreet is expected to add eight new operators to its roster of high-quality operating partners and reduce the concentration of its largest operator Symphony, from 56% to 32%. Furthermore, assuming completion of the Transaction, Mainstreet will operate in 18 states and provinces and its concentration in the State of Illinois will be reduced to 31% from 54%.

Increases Exposure to Private Pay Sector: The Portfolio primarily consists of private pay independent living, assisted living and memory care properties that represent approximately 80% of the Portfolio’s suites/beds. Following the completion of the Transaction, Mainstreet’s portfolio will be comprised of approximately 52% independent living, assisted living and memory care suites and 48% skilled nursing and transitional care beds.

Attractive Transaction Metrics: The Consideration represents a going-in capitalization rate of approximately 7.7%. Mainstreet is funding the equity portion of the Consideration through the issuance of Mainstreet common shares directly to Tiptree.

Validation of Embedded Value and Addition of New Strategic Investor: Upon closing, Tiptree will become Mainstreet’s largest shareholder with an ownership interest of approximately 34%. Tiptree will receive Mainstreet shares based upon a fixed issuance price of US$9.75 per common share.

Accretive Transaction: The Transaction is expected to be accretive to the Company’s 2018E Adjusted Funds from Operations per share. The Company also expects to achieve additional synergies over time from operational efficiencies and debt consolidation, neither of which are included in the Company’s underwriting and financial analysis.

CareIT Portfolio Details

The Portfolio is comprised of 35 independent living, assisted living and memory care properties with 2,962 suites and 7 skilled nursing properties with 756 beds. The Portfolio has an attractive quality mix with more than 80% of revenue expected to be derived from private pay funding sources. The Portfolio is located in attractive and growing markets throughout the Eastern and Southern United States and the properties are similar in quality to Mainstreet’s existing portfolio. The Portfolio consists of 24 properties leased to operators under long-term triple-net leases and 18 operating properties in joint venture arrangements with operators in which Mainstreet will own the majority of the real estate and the operations.
